This isn't actually shaping up to be a particularly large release: we "only" have 11.5k non-merge commits during this merge window, compared to 13.5k last time around. So not exactly tiny, but smaller than the last few releases. At least in number of commits. That said, we've got a few core things that have been brewing for a long time, most notably the multi-gen LRU VM series, and the initial Rust scaffolding (no actual real Rust code in the kernel yet, but the infrastructure is there). Talking about frustration, let me just say that after I got my machine sorted out and caught up with the merge window, I wass somewhat frustrated with various late pull requests. I've mentioned this before, but it's _really_ quite annoying to get quite a few pull requests in the last few days of the merge window. Yes, the merge window is two weeks, but that's very much to allow me time to look things over, not "two weeks to hurriedly put together a branch that you send Linus on Friday of the second week". The whole "do an all-nighter to get the paper in the day before the dealine" is something that should have gone out the window after highschool. Not for kernel development. The rule is that things that get sent to me should be ready *before* the merge window opens, not be made ready during the merge window. With some slack for "life happens", of course, but I really get the feeling that a few people treat the end of the merge window as a deadline, missing the whole "it was supposed to be ready before the merge window". You know who you are. Anyway, it's not the first time I've said this, I doubt it will be the last. But maybe more people could take it to heart, ok?
